Device for and method for detecting a relative movement between two machine parts which are movable relative to one another

1. A device for detecting a relative movement between two machine parts which are movable relative to one another, comprising a plurality of marking lines adapted to be arranged on one of the machine parts one after the other in a direction of the relative movement of the machine parts, said marking lines having increment markings for detecting a distance of a relative movement of the both machine parts;

  • two sensors provided for sensing of the marking lines and adapted to be arranged on the other of the machine parts at a predetermined distance in the direction of relative movement of the machine parts, said sensors sensing said increment markings and each providing a sensing signal, said marking lines being arranged so that distances between two neighboring ones of said marking lines being smaller than said predetermined distance between said sensors; and

    an evaluating unit operative for determining an absolute position of the corresponding sensor between two successive increment markings based on a phase position of the sensing signal of the sensors, wherein a preceding one of the sensors is considered in the direction of relative movement and is configured to detect a transition signal comprised in said sensing signal and indicative of a transition from one of the marking rulers to another marking ruler, so that said evaluating unit detects a phase deviation between a sensing signal of the subsequent one of the sensors located in a region of one of the marking rulers and the sensing signal of the preceding one of the sensors located in the region of the other marking ruler, and also taking into consideration a phase correction determined on the basis of the phase deviation when the subsequent sensor is located in the region of the other marking ruler, during the detecting of the relative movement of the both machine parts.
